| role | description |
|---|---|
| celebrity publicist | Manage public image, media relations, and crisis communication for high-profile clients. |
| talent manager | Oversee career development, contracts, and brand partnerships for celebrities. |
| social media strategist | Develop and execute social media campaigns to enhance celebrity brands and engagement. |
| brand ambassador coordinator | Facilitate partnerships between celebrities and brands for endorsements and campaigns. |
| event and red carpet manager | Coordinate appearances, interviews, and events to maximize celebrity exposure. |
| crisis communication specialist | Handle reputation management and damage control for celebrities during controversies. |
| entertainment journalist | Report on celebrity news, interviews, and industry trends for media outlets. |
